The Product Manager at Workstream will lead key product areas within the company's platform, focusing on enhancing how hourly businesses hire, manage, and retain their workforce. This role involves defining product strategy, roadmap, and long-term vision, encompassing customer discovery, hypothesis development, execution, iteration, and achieving measurable business outcomes. The Product Manager will collaborate closely with cross-functional teams, including Engineering, Design, Sales, Customer Success, Business Development, and Leadership, to identify opportunities, prioritize resources, and bring impactful products to market.

Key responsibilities include owning the product strategy and execution for a core product area, defining product vision and success criteria aligned with company priorities, and engaging with customers and users to identify patterns, pain points, and market opportunities. The role also involves partnering with Sales, Customer Success, Business Development, and Operations to gather business requirements and translate them into scalable product solutions. Additionally, the Product Manager will build and manage relationships with strategic external partners, conduct market and competitive research, take a hypothesis-driven approach to product discovery, write detailed product specifications, and collaborate closely with Engineering and Design teams to ship products efficiently.

The ideal candidate will have 5-7+ years of Product Management experience, preferably in SaaS, growth, marketplace, or startup environments. Experience utilizing AI tools to enhance team effectiveness and an understanding of the AI landscape are important. The candidate should have a proven track record of owning product initiatives from concept through launch and iteration, strong customer empathy, excellent analytical and strategic problem-solving skills, exceptional communication abilities, and the capacity to operate resourcefully in ambiguous environments. Experience writing product specifications and translating business needs into product execution is also required.

Compensation for this role includes a base salary range of $150,000 to $170,000 in San Francisco, not inclusive of discretionary bonuses or equity packages. The company offers comprehensive health coverage, including medical, dental, and vision, with 95% of premiums covered for employees and 85% for dependents. Additional benefits include a 401K plan, pre-tax commuter benefits, and flexible PTO.

Workstream is a mission-driven company dedicated to empowering deskless workers and local businesses. As an early employee at a Series B hyper-growth startup, the Product Manager will have the opportunity to work with the founding team and industry veterans, accelerating their career in a dynamic and fast-paced environment.
